Japan Blockchain in Financial Technology Market Size Analysis: Addressable Demand and Growth Potential

The Japan Blockchain in Financial Technology market is positioned at a pivotal growth juncture, driven by technological innovation, regulatory support, and increasing adoption of digital assets. Analyzing market size involves understanding the Total Addressable Market (TAM), Serviceable Available Market (SAM), and Serviceable Obtainable Market (SOM), grounded in realistic assumptions and segmentation logic.

  • Total Addressable Market (TAM): Estimated at approximately USD 5.5 billion by 2028, reflecting the global scope of blockchain-enabled financial services, including payments, remittances, asset management, and decentralized finance (DeFi). Japan’s share of this global TAM is projected at around 15-20%, considering its technological infrastructure and financial sector maturity.
  • Serviceable Available Market (SAM): Focused on Japan’s domestic financial ecosystem, the SAM is estimated at USD 1.2 billion in 2028. This encompasses blockchain-based payment solutions, digital asset custody, smart contract platforms, and blockchain infrastructure services tailored for Japanese financial institutions and fintech firms.
  • Serviceable Obtainable Market (SOM): Realistically, within the next 3-5 years, the SOM is projected at USD 300-500 million. This reflects the initial penetration achievable by early movers, considering regulatory hurdles, market readiness, and competitive landscape.

Market segmentation logic is based on:

  • Application areas: Payments & remittances, asset management, identity verification, smart contracts, and DeFi.
  • Customer segments: Traditional banks, fintech startups, large corporations, government agencies, and retail consumers.
  • Geographic focus: Urban centers like Tokyo, Osaka, and Nagoya, where financial activity density is highest.

Adoption rates are projected to grow from 5-10% in 2024 to approximately 25-30% by 2028 among targeted financial institutions and fintech players, driven by regulatory clarity, technological maturity, and increasing demand for efficient, transparent financial services.

Japan Blockchain in Financial Technology Market Commercialization Outlook & Revenue Opportunities

The commercialization landscape in Japan offers compelling revenue streams, underpinned by innovative business models and strategic demand drivers. The market’s attractiveness is enhanced by Japan’s advanced financial infrastructure, high digital literacy, and proactive regulatory environment.

  • Business Model Attractiveness & Revenue Streams:
    •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S) and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) offerings for blockchain deployment.
    • Transaction fees from blockchain-based payments, remittances, and asset transfers.
    • Subscription models for enterprise blockchain solutions, including identity management and compliance tools.
    • Tokenization services for real estate, securities, and commodities, generating revenue through issuance and secondary trading.
  • Growth Drivers & Demand Acceleration Factors:
    • Regulatory clarity and supportive policies fostering innovation.
    • Increasing institutional interest in digital assets and blockchain-based custody solutions.
    • Growing consumer demand for secure, transparent digital financial services.
    • Technological advancements reducing transaction costs and settlement times.
  • Segment-wise Opportunities:
    • By Region: Tokyo metropolitan area as the primary hub, with secondary growth in Osaka and Nagoya.
    • By Application: Payments & remittances, digital asset custody, smart contracts, and KYC/AML compliance solutions.
    • By Customer Type: Banks, securities firms, insurance companies, fintech startups, and government agencies.
  • Scalability Challenges & Operational Bottlenecks:
    • High integration complexity with legacy banking systems.
    • Limited interoperability across different blockchain platforms.
    • Talent shortages in blockchain development and cybersecurity expertise.
    • Operational costs associated with compliance and regulatory reporting.
  • Regulatory Landscape, Certifications, & Compliance Timelines:
    • Japan’s Financial Services Agency (FSA) provides clear guidelines for crypto exchanges and token offerings.
    • Expected timeline for full regulatory adoption and licensing reforms: 12-24 months.
    • Emerging standards for security, AML, and data privacy to shape product development and deployment.

Japan Blockchain in Financial Technology Market Trends & Recent Developments

Staying abreast of industry trends and recent developments is critical for strategic positioning. The Japan blockchain fintech sector is witnessing rapid innovation, strategic partnerships, and regulatory evolution.

  • Technological Innovations & Product Launches:
    • Introduction of scalable Layer 2 solutions to enhance transaction throughput.
    • Launch of enterprise-grade blockchain platforms tailored for financial institutions.
    • Development of digital asset custody and security solutions compliant with Japanese standards.
  • Strategic Partnerships, Mergers, & Acquisitions:
    • Major banks partnering with blockchain startups to pilot cross-border payment solutions.
    • Fintech firms acquiring or merging with blockchain technology providers to expand service offerings.
    • Collaborations between government agencies and private sector to develop national digital currency initiatives.
  • Regulatory Updates & Policy Changes:
    • FSA’s ongoing consultation on stablecoin regulation and digital currency issuance.
    • Implementation of AML/KYC standards aligned with international best practices.
    • Proposed frameworks for tokenized securities and digital asset exchanges.
  • Competitive Landscape Shifts:
    • Emergence of domestic blockchain consortia focused on financial services.
    • Increased activity from global fintech giants establishing local R&D hubs.
    • Growing presence of venture capital funding and accelerators supporting blockchain startups.
